Small Intimate Weddings: Private Dining Options for Your Special Day

Small intimate weddings are becoming increasingly popular, especially these days when many couples look for unique and personalized ways to celebrate their love. If you’re planning a small wedding and searching for a more intimate setting, consider hosting it in a private dining room or area. Here are some incredible private dining options for your big day:

  1. Private dining rooms

Many restaurants have private dining rooms perfect for small and intimate weddings. These rooms offer privacy, personalized service, and a unique ambiance. Private dining rooms vary in size, accommodating anywhere from 10 to 100 guests, depending on the restaurant. The design and decor of these rooms can also vary, from sleek & modern to more traditional.

One of the benefits of choosing a private dining room for your small wedding is the level of customization available. You can work closely with the restaurant’s event team to create a personalized menu and decor to suit your taste and style. Some restaurants also offer custom seating plans and AV equipment to ensure every detail of your special day is perfect.

  1. Restaurants’ outdoor spaces

Looking for a more relaxed & casual atmosphere for your small wedding? Some restaurants have outdoor spaces—such as patios, rooftop areas, or gardens—that can be transformed into a beautiful wedding ceremony or reception venue. Outdoor spaces offer a beautiful backdrop for your big day and can accommodate more guests than indoor private dining rooms.

If you want a more unconventional option, consider restaurants that offer private dining on a boat or yacht. This unique experience can provide breathtaking views of the water and skyline, making it an unforgettable location for your wedding.

Also, restaurants’ outdoor spaces—no matter where they are—provide more flexibility in decor and design. You and the event team can work closely to decorate the outdoor area with flowers, lighting, and other elements to create a romantic and intimate atmosphere.

  1. Buyouts

For couples who want complete privacy and exclusivity, some restaurants offer the option of buying out the entire restaurant for the evening. This option can accommodate larger guest lists and allows for more flexibility in terms of decor and menu options. Buying out a restaurant is a great option for couples who want to create a truly unique experience.

At Blu Ristorante, we offer a full buyout of our restaurant for small weddings. This private dining option allows you to enjoy your big day with up to 110 guests in a perfect setting.

  1. Semi-private spaces

Some restaurants have semi-private spaces that offer a balance of privacy and openness. These spaces may have partial walls or dividers that create a sense of intimacy while still allowing for some interaction with other diners. Semi-private spaces are ideal for smaller weddings that want to create a more intimate and exclusive atmosphere while still enjoying the energy and ambiance of a bustling restaurant.

  1. Chef’s table

Are you and your soon-to-be spouse passionate about food? A chef’s table experience can be a great option for your small wedding. This option offers a unique and immersive dining experience where guests can watch the chefs prepare and plate each course. Chef’s tables are typically located in the restaurant’s kitchen or a dining area adjacent to the kitchen.

The benefits of a chef’s table experience for your small wedding include a unique and immersive dining experience. These also include personalized attention from the restaurant’s chefs and the ability to create a customized menu that highlights your favorite foods and flavors.

7 Reasons You Should Try Private Dining in Toronto

Whether you’re planning to throw a corporate dinner party or an intimate event with friends or family, hiring private dining rooms can be a great choice. That’s especially true if Toronto is your target location. Toronto is home to many incredible private dining rooms that can offer your guests an impressive ambiance, food, and dining experience. Still not convinced? Read on as we’ve listed the seven good reasons you should try private dining in Toronto. 

1. A sense of exclusivity

With private dining rooms in Toronto restaurants, you don’t have to worry about other guests disturbing or interfering with your event. Similarly, you don’t have to think about your party being too loud or bothersome for other diners. You can even organize a program or activity in addition to the dinner itself without worrying about other people in the restaurant. You and your guests can enjoy the amazing food, ambiance, and dining experience to the fullest! 

 

2. Impeccable service

Private dining areas usually have a designated catering staff that will give you their full attention. With no other customers to serve, the well-trained staff can quickly attend to your guests’ needs and ensure they have a great time during the dinner service. Some private dining venues in Toronto even offer special table service or a private butler who ensures the designated staff lives up to your expectations. That is a classy experience that will surely make your family party, a holiday party with friends, or a corporate event fun & memorable. 

 

3. Curated menus

When you book private dining in Toronto, you will likely have the option to have well-curated menus for your event. You can talk to the restaurant about the menu before the event. That will help you better plan your event budget. Curated menus can also help you keep an eye on your guests’ dietary requirements. It’s best to ask your guests about their dietary needs and allergies before the event. That way, you can talk to the chef to provide vegetarian, vegan, or gluten-free options and adjust some choices for those with food allergies. 

 

4. Better control over costing

Apart from the food menu, you can curate the drinks menu when you hire a private venue. That’s a huge help since beverages are often one of the highest costs in group parties. You can coordinate with the restaurant to only offer your guests wines, cocktails, and other drinks that suit your budget. If possible, ask to pre-select the beverages to be included in the menu. That way, you don’t have to worry about the bill when your guests start ordering drinks. 

5. A versatile venue

Need to plan a birthday and a corporate dinner in the same month? You can hire the same private venue. Most private dining rooms in Toronto are highly versatile spaces, making them suitable for a variety of occasions & functions. They often have luxurious interiors you can customize to suit your event or theme. Plus, most of these venues have or are at least willing to provide audio-visual equipment and any other tools you may need for your event. In turn, your guests can comfortably deliver a speech or participate in any activity you’ve set. 

 

6. Less planning 

When you book a private dining venue, many planning tasks are taken off your plate. These tasks include hiring a catering service, renting equipment & furniture pieces, handling the seating arrangement, and many more. You can sit back as the professionals do what they do best and help you mount the event that impresses your family, friends, or colleagues. 

 

7. No need to clean up

When hosting parties at home, your job isn’t finished when the guests leave. You still need to clean up a probably overwhelming mess. But that shouldn’t be a worry when you book a private dining room in Toronto. The restaurant staff is tasked to clean up after the event. That way, you can enjoy the event to the fullest and not worry about tidying up afterward.

Private Dining Toronto: How to Choose The Perfect Event Venue

Have an upcoming event in Toronto but not sure how to pick a venue? 

If you’re looking for a place in downtown Toronto, there are quite a few Yorkville restaurants with private dining rooms, beautiful patios, and good food. 

But before you finalize and reserve a place for the event, you have to keep in mind some vital factors. Here’s a quick guide to help you choose the perfect event venue in Toronto. 

1. How’s the Ambiance? 

The ambiance of the venue sets the mood of the event. Whether it’s a corporate event or a private celebration, you don’t want the venue to be so loud and happening that you can hardly spend quality time with your guests. Look for a place that has a soothing and cheerful atmosphere, where both you and your guests will have a gala time, and the event will be a success. 

Blu Risitorante | Private Dining in Toronto

2. Convenient Location

When you’re choosing a private dining event venue, the location has to be easily accessible for everyone. So try to pick a place that’s situated in a well-connected locality, where there are ample amounts of public transport available. If you have people coming over from different cities, it’s important they can easily navigate the venue without complications. 

3. Seating Capacity

Another crucial thing you have to consider is the seating capacity of the place you’re booking. If you have a guest list of 20 people, you don’t need a massive venue—a small one or a specific portion of a larger venue would be sufficient. And likewise, if your event will have a large number of attendees, you need a space that can comfortably accommodate all the people. Before you finalize a venue, take a look at the available space yourself, and inquire with the manager of the venue about its seating capacity. 

Blu Ristorante | The best ambiance for a nice private dining experience

4. Parking Capacity 

Not just seating, you’ll also have to make sure the venue has enough parking space for your guests. It’s always a good idea to have a prior estimate of the number of cars you’d be expecting because a lack of parking area could create a big mess on the day of the event. Check with the venue manager for the parking capacity of the space you’re planning to book. 

5. Is It Indoor or Outdoor? 

When you’re hosting an event, you can choose either an indoor space or an outdoor space as the venue. Indoor seating or private dining rooms are often the most preferred option, because they keep you protected from unpredictable weather changes, offer privacy, and feel cozier in general. But if the event is during summer or fall and there’s no chance of rain, you could very much enjoy your event under bright sunshine. So first decide whether you’d like to go outdoors or indoors, and then find a suitable place. 

Blue Ristorante | Chose indoor space or an outdoor space as the venue with us.

6. What’s on the Menu? 

A vital part of your event is the food. Before deciding on a venue, know about its catering menu, the cuisines and drinks that they will be serving, and whether you can customize the menu or not. If you’re booking a restaurant, you might speak to the chefs about their specialty dishes that will surely impress your guests. 

7. Bonus Tip: Plan in Advance 

Be it a personal or corporate event, the key to a successful event is to plan in advance, if possible. From budget to guest list, food, venue, and other logistics—you’ll be able to manage everything perfectly when you have enough time at hand. Moreover, restaurants Toronto with private dining rooms can get reserved quite fast, so the earlier you make your booking, the better.
